<TEI xmlns="http://www.tei-c.org/ns/1.0" xmlns:py="http://codespeak.net/lxml/objectify/pytype" py:pytype="TREE"><text><body><div type="translation" n="urn:cts:greekLit:tlg0010.tlg015.perseus-eng2" xml:lang="eng"><div n="80" subtype="section" type="textpart"><p> It is my task, therefore, and that of your other friends, to speak and to write in such
          fashion as may be likely to incite you to strive eagerly after those things which even now
          you do in fact desire: and you it behooves not to be negligent, but as at present so in
          the future to pay heed to yourself and to discipline your mind that you may be worthy of
          your father and of all your ancestors. For though it is the duty of all to place a high
          value upon wisdom, yet you kings especially should do so, who have power over very many
          and weighty affairs. </p></div></div></body></text></TEI>
